In spite of the victory of the Unione in the Upper House (Senato) and the Lower House (Camera), the news programmes are still buzzing with dialectical inventions about defeats or really about the defeat.
If I am permitted, I would like to invite the newspapers and the TV channels to have a greater sense of reality. Let it be clear that I am not referring to those of the former President of the Council that are simply propaganda channels and not true information channels.
Let the journalists now discuss the real problems of the country. The previous legislature has left us with so many problems that we have too many to choose from.
Last night I watched the programme Ballarò. I heard arguments put forward asking “out of a sense of responsibility” for a coalition of the representatives of those who have torn to shreds the Constitution and the laws of Parliament.
By the one who called the centre left voters “coglioni”.
It gave me an allergic reaction.

Here is a very modest piece of advice to my colleagues in the Unione: If you are invited to take part in a programme to talk about the null proposition of the current opposition, don’t accept.
When you do appear on TV talk about data, numbers, statistics related to what the Unione will do for Italian citizens.
In answer to the umpteenth provocation about the “grand coalition”, my opinion is that the bipolar system obliges the winning coalition to govern to give the country the alternative determined by voting.
In other words, let the winner govern.
